What is a trade development manager?

Trade Development Managers are professionals responsible for identifying and developing new business opportunities within specific markets or regions. They work to increase a company's sales by building strong relationships with distributors, retailers, and other partners. Their duties often include analyzing market trends, creating promotional strategies, and coordinating marketing or sales activities to maximize growth. Trade Development Managers also negotiate contracts and ensure that their company's products or services are well-positioned in the marketplace.

How does a trade development manager typically collaborate with sales and marketing teams to achieve business objectives?

A Trade Development Manager works closely with both sales and marketing teams to design and implement strategies that drive product visibility and increase market share. This involves coordinating promotional activities, analyzing market trends, and providing sales teams with the tools and insights needed to optimize performance. Regular meetings and joint planning sessions are common, ensuring alignment on trade priorities and execution of campaigns. This collaborative approach helps ensure that trade initiatives are both effective and aligned with broader business goals.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a trade development man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Trade Development Manager, you need strong analytical skills, a solid understanding of market trends, and experience in sales or business development, usually supported by a relevant degree in business or marketing. Familiarity with CRM systems, trade marketing software, and data analysis tools is typically required. Excellent negotiation, relationship-building, and communication skills help you foster strong partnerships and drive business growth. These competencies are vital for identifying opportunities, executing effective trade strategies, and achieving revenue targets in competitive markets.

What is the difference between Trade Development Manager vs Sales Executive?

AspectTrade Development ManagerSales Executive
Primary FocusDeveloping trade relationships, expanding market presence, and strategic partnershipsGenerating sales, closing deals, and meeting sales targets
Required CredentialsRelevant industry experience, possibly a degree in business or marketingSales experience, often with a focus on customer engagement
Work EnvironmentOffice-based with travel to trade shows, client sites, and industry eventsField-based, visiting clients and prospects
Employer & Industry UsageCommon in manufacturing, wholesale, and distribution sectorsWidely used across retail, B2B, and service industries

While both roles involve client interaction and industry knowledge, the Trade Development Manager focuses on strategic trade growth and partnerships, whereas the Sales Executive concentrates on direct sales and revenue generation. The Large Loss Project Manager we need is a self-confident, outgoing, and fast moving professional who enjoys working in a dynamic environment. If you possess an entrepreneurial spirit, are comfortable making decisions when risks are present, and can influence customers and team members with your persuasive style - keep reading!

As a Large Loss Project Manager, you will work with Business or Residential Owners and sub-contractors after disasters such as a fire or flood to clean up and repair damage to residential and commercial property. You will oversee all aspects of the reconstruction and renovation process from intake to completion. In this role, you will work directly with homeowners, commercial property owners, project coordinators, sub-contractors, and technicians while maintaining the highest levels of customer service. This position involves monitoring project plans, schedules, work hours, budgets, collections, and ensuring that project deadlines are met.
